The Florida Project 2017
Ending 2024 with such a special film.
Reminded me of Aluísio Azevedo’s novel O Cortiço, with its colorful characters and where the story unfolds (mostly) in the perimeters of a center stage location.
It also made think of Azevedo’s naturalism in the sense that every scene feels tangible. I can feel the summer’s heat, I can smell cigarettes, I can hear the children playing about the corridors and causing mischief.

The Zone of Interest 2023
Have to admit I had high expectations coming in to this movie, since it's been 11 years since director Jonathan Glazer's phenomenal last picture Under the Skin.
Needless to say, this film exceeded my expectations and I believe it just might be my favorite from this director.
